What is the purpose of placement testing?
Placement tests help determine how prepared you are for college level coursework in one or more academic areas. The placement test results will be used to determine the most appropriate courses for you as you move forward with college coursework. After you take a placement test(s), you and your advisor will review your results and schedule the best classes for you based on your scores.
